Why the AI Playground Isn’t a Safe Backyard for Kids
Parents today are confronted with a digital landscape that feels more like a sprawling, uncharted playground than a tidy, fenced yard, and the allure of instantly generated cartoons, jokes, and chat companions can seem harmless at first glance, yet beneath the glossy veneer lies a complex web of algorithmic bias, data harvesting, and persuasive design that can subtly shape a child’s worldview, language patterns, and sense of privacy in ways that traditional toys never could; this invisible architecture operates on the principle of maximizing engagement, often by exploiting curiosity and emotional triggers, which means that even a brief interaction with an AI chatbot can set off a cascade of personalized content that escalates in intensity and specificity without a parent’s knowledge or consent. Understanding how these systems learn from each keystroke is essential because the same feedback loop that powers a clever joke can also reinforce stereotypes, spread misinformation, or coax a child into sharing personal details that become part of a data profile sold to advertisers. Moreover, the rapid pace of model updates means that what was benign yesterday can morph into a more invasive or manipulative version tomorrow, turning an innocent curiosity into a long‑term exposure risk that parents must actively monitor and mitigate.
The Unseen Persuasion Engine Behind Kid‑Friendly AI
When a child asks an AI assistant for a bedtime story, the response is often crafted with colorful language and interactive prompts that seem tailored to spark imagination, yet those very prompts are engineered to keep the user scrolling, tapping, or speaking longer, because engagement metrics directly translate into ad revenue or data collection opportunities for the platform’s owners, and the line between entertainment and subtle persuasion blurs when the system begins to suggest new games, challenges, or “fun facts” that are carefully selected to match the child’s demonstrated interests, thereby creating a feedback loop that can entrench niche content consumption patterns before the child even learns to question the source; this dynamic is amplified by the fact that many AI services are embedded in devices that double as smart speakers, tablets, and toys, allowing them to listen constantly for activation phrases and to store voice samples that can later be used to refine voice‑recognition models or even generate synthetic voices for future interactions. Parents who assume that a whimsical narrative is harmless may inadvertently grant a platform a foothold inside the family’s private moments, a foothold that can be leveraged for targeted marketing, data mining, or more insidious manipulation that capitalizes on the child’s trust in a seemingly benevolent digital companion.
Legal Gaps and Liability: Who’s Responsible When AI Goes Wrong?
In the rapidly evolving arena of artificial intelligence, the legal framework lags behind technological advancement, leaving a gray zone where accountability for harmful content or data breaches is often ambiguous, and while regulators are beginning to draft legislation aimed at protecting minors online, the enforcement mechanisms remain uneven across provinces, meaning that a child exposed to a disturbing image generated by an AI art model may have limited recourse, especially if the platform’s terms of service place responsibility on the user to monitor content; this uncertainty is further complicated by the fact that AI outputs are not always attributable to a single entity, as many services rely on open‑source models that are continuously fine‑tuned by a community of developers, creating a diffusion of ownership that makes it challenging to pinpoint who should be held liable for a harmful recommendation or a breach of privacy. Psychological Impacts: From Attention Spans to Identity Formation
Beyond the immediate safety concerns, the psychological ramifications of unrestricted AI interaction can be profound, as children’s developing brains are highly susceptible to the reward‑driven loops embedded in conversational agents that dispense instant answers, jokes, or affirmations, potentially shortening attention spans and diminishing the patience required for deep, reflective learning, while the constant exposure to AI‑generated personas may also blur the lines between authentic human interaction and synthetic dialogue, leading to confusion about emotional cues, empathy, and the nuances of real‑world conversation; studies in developmental psychology suggest that when children receive consistent validation from a non‑human source, they may begin to model their self‑esteem on algorithmic feedback rather than on the messier, more rewarding validation from peers and caregivers, a shift that can affect confidence, social skills, and even the formation of a stable sense of self. Practical Safeguards for the Modern Household
Implementing concrete safeguards does not require turning the home into a technology‑free zone, but rather establishing clear boundaries, employing parental controls that restrict AI access during certain hours, and fostering open dialogues about the nature of synthetic content, and one effective strategy is to designate “AI‑free” zones such as the dining table or bedtime routine, where conversation is deliberately human‑centered, thereby reinforcing the value of face‑to‑face communication and ensuring that children develop the habit of seeking answers from trusted adults before turning to a digital assistant; another critical measure involves regularly reviewing the privacy settings of any smart devices, disabling data sharing where possible, and opting out of voice‑recording storage, because even when a child’s interactions seem innocuous, the aggregated data can reveal patterns that advertisers or third‑party developers might exploit for profit or influence. Finally, educating children about the concept of “deepfakes” and AI‑generated misinformation empowers them to ask critical questions, a skill that becomes increasingly vital as they encounter more sophisticated media in school and on social platforms.
Choosing the Right Tools: Quality Over Quantity
Not all AI applications are created equal, and discerning parents should prioritize platforms that demonstrate transparency, robust moderation policies, and a commitment to child safety, which often translates into clear age‑based content filters, regular audits by independent safety experts, and the ability for parents to review conversation histories, and while the market is saturated with chatbots marketed as “educational” or “fun,” many of these rely on open‑ended language models that lack consistent oversight, increasing the risk of inappropriate or biased responses; therefore, conducting thorough research, reading third‑party reviews, and even testing the interface yourself before allowing a child to engage can reveal hidden pitfalls that are not evident in promotional material. Balancing Innovation with Caution: A Future‑Focused Outlook
As AI continues to weave itself into the fabric of everyday life, the challenge for parents is not to reject innovation outright but to cultivate a mindset that balances curiosity with caution, recognizing that the same algorithms that can generate a whimsical bedtime story can also produce disinformation or subtly steer a child toward consumerist habits, and this duality requires a dynamic approach that evolves alongside the technology, incorporating periodic reassessments of device settings, staying abreast of legislative changes, and fostering a family culture where questioning and critical thinking are celebrated as much as creativity; by establishing a framework that includes scheduled tech‑free intervals, collaborative rule‑making with children, and consistent monitoring of emerging AI trends, families can transform potential threats into teachable moments that empower the next generation to navigate a world where the line between human and machine‑generated content grows increasingly indistinct. Ultimately, the goal is to ensure that the digital playground remains a place of wonder rather than a hidden minefield, preserving the innocence of childhood while equipping kids with the tools they need to thrive in an AI‑augmented reality.
